codeforces round 935 (div. 3)(a~e)-爱代码爱编程
A. Setting up Camp a,必须要一个人住。 b,必须要三个人住。 c,无所谓(1~3人) 问最少要几个帐篷。 a一定要一个人住,所以最少a个帐篷。 b要三个人住,如果b不是三的倍数,就从c那边拿人过来,帐篷再加b/3 如果c是负数,则无法完成分配,输出负一。 不是负数就把c全部安排三人间,有余数再加1。 #incl
代码编织梦想
A. Setting up Camp a,必须要一个人住。 b,必须要三个人住。 c,无所谓(1~3人) 问最少要几个帐篷。 a一定要一个人住,所以最少a个帐篷。 b要三个人住,如果b不是三的倍数,就从c那边拿人过来,帐篷再加b/3 如果c是负数,则无法完成分配,输出负一。 不是负数就把c全部安排三人间,有余数再加1。 #incl
好多都是之前的原题,甚至有上次第二届全国大学生信息技术认证挑战赛的原题,刚打完又来一遍,没绷住。 A. 手机 原题之一,具体出处忘了 最无脑的方法直接用map记录每个按下的值就行了,代码仅供参考。 #include <bits/stdc++.h> //#define int long long #define per(i,j
A - Divisible 如果序列里面的数能被k整除,就整除后输出 #include <bits/stdc++.h> //#define int long long #define per(i,j,k) for(int (i)=(j);(i)<=(k);++(i)) #define rep(i,j,k) for(int (i)=(j
A. Brick Wall 读题不谨慎翻车半小时,警惕黑体加粗的单词,真的很重要。 给你n高,m宽的方框,往里面放 1*k 大小的砖头,k自己选,但是>=2,塞满方框的情况并且不超出边界,输出最大的平衡值(横砖数量减去竖砖数量)(同时方框里面 k 可以不全都是一样的) 就是 Note 后面的一段,没看到的话这道题就难做了(指样例一直过不了到
赛后gym练习及补题,gym链接:2023 (ICPC) Jiangxi Provincial Contest – Official Contest 补题顺序 L [Zhang Fei Threading N
哈喽,今天要给你分享的话题是······· 如何致富(不靠运气) 或许这是所有创业者想知道的答案,很多时候,你之所以焦虑,不是因为当下口袋里没有钱,而是对未来的不确定性,你不知道哪天如果没有钱了,你还能不能东山再起,关于这个问题······· 硅谷知名天使投资人,一位印度平民窟出来的亿万富翁给出了这样的答复: “假设有一天,我创业失败,身
目录 一、精益开发与敏捷开发的比较 1、核心理念 2、实践方式 3、应用场景 4、总结 二、门径流程 VS 敏捷方法 1、定义与特点 门径管理流程 敏捷方法 2、应用场景 3、比较 4、总结 三、集成产品开发 VS 系统工程 VS 设计思维 1、集成产品开发(IPD) 2、系统工程 3、设计思维 4、比较与总结 四、敏捷
目录 前言: 一、详细设计与规格定义概述 1、产品详细设计 2、规格定义 3、详细设计与规格定义的关系 4、实际应用中的注意事项 二、详细设计与规格定义主要工具 2.1 质量功能展开QFD - 需求跟踪矩阵 1、QFD的基本原理 2、QFD的实施步骤 3、QFD的优势与应用价值 4、QFD的未来发展 2.2 稳健设计/鲁棒性设计
目录 一、复杂的事情简单化 二、简单的事情标准化 1、标准化的定义与意义 2、简单事情标准化的实施步骤 3、标准化的案例分析 三、标准的事情流程化 1、流程化的定义与意义 2、标准事情流程化的实施步骤 3、流程化的案例分析 四、流程的事情数字化 1、定义与意义 2、实施步骤 3、关键技术 4、案例分析 五、数字化的事情自动化
Problem - D - Codeforces 通过贪心观察均分的最优性质;常规思路是三分枚举,每次O(n)维护各点权值; 变化属性的加法运算可以通过差分相邻项,对前项 + ,对后项 - 实现变化值的维护; #include <bits/stdc++.h> #define int long long using namespace st
文章目录 ESP8266简介基于连接电脑串口与网络调试助手连接简单调试连接服务器经常出现的问题ERROR 0,CLOSED | ERROR CLOSED电脑的IP不对(一直连接不上可以看看是不是这个问题)
感觉区分度不明显,D题之后感觉都有arc的难度了。 A - TLD 输出字符串最后一个.之后的内容,比如www.baidu.com,输出com 扫一遍输出 #include <bits/stdc++.h> //#define int long long #define per(i,j,k) for(int (i)=(j);(i)<
C-小苯的排列构造_北京信息科技大学第十五届程序设计竞赛(同步赛) (nowcoder.com) 凑2很容易想出来,但是2 4 1 3 这个内核不好想,算是一种尝试和经验吧 #include<bits/stdc++.h> using namespace std; int n; int main() { c
小白赛怎么这么难打,是什么小白,我的世界小白吗。 A. 伊甸之花 给你一个数组 a,问你是否找出一个 不等于 a 的数组 b,满足 其中数值都要在 [1,m] 的范围内 直接在 a 数组上修改,可以发现如果改了 a[1],a[2],那么 a[3] 也要一起修改,所以考虑两个极限情况,一个是全体加一,还有一个是全体减一。 #include
思路 dp(u,count)为当前再考虑下标为1-u的墙面,并且还有count免费工次的最小代价 主要是递归边界的选择: u+1<=count return 0; if(u==-1&&count<0)return 0x3f3f3f3f; if(u==-1&&count==0)retrun 0
看到一篇蛮有思考意义的文章就摘录下来了,也引起了反思 目录 一、视频的定义 二、”视频媒介“与”文字媒介”作对比 1.形象 VS 抽象 2.被动 VS 主动 三、视频的缺点-【更少】的思考 1.看视频为啥会导致【更少的思考】 2.内容的【浅薄化】 3.内容的【娱乐化】 3.1不同于“浅薄化”的“娱乐化” 3.2浅薄化/娱乐化”的结果—
解析 对于单调递增序列肯定是唯一的,对于序列进行排序即为最终结果,然后遍历统计多少种情况可以形成该序列。 #include<bits/stdc++.h> using namespace std; #def
目录 第1章 深度思考概述 1.1 深度思考的本质 1.2 深度思考的冰山模型 1.3 行为模式:结构与现象之间的桥梁 第2章 复杂多变的现象背后的六种基本的行为模式 第3章 透过模式/趋势看清内在的结构 第1章 深度思考概述 1.1 深度思考的本质 结构决定功能,是指事物的功能都是由结构来决定的,有什么样的结构就会有什么样的功能。